1960-04-27

This date is celebrated as Togo's Independence Day. It marks the day in 1960 when the nation, formerly a UN Trust Territory under French administration, gained its full sovereignty and independence.

Personality Profile

Togo is a slender West African nation that packs an incredible diversity of landscapes into its narrow territory, stretching from the Gulf of Guinea deep into the savanna. It is home to the Koutammakou, a UNESCO World Heritage site, where the Batammariba people live in remarkable, traditional mud tower-houses that are a living symbol of the nation's deep-rooted traditions. Togo is also known as a major center for the traditional Vodun religion, with its capital, Lomé, hosting the world's largest fetish market, a powerful window into ancient spiritual practices. Traveling through Togo is like journeying through a miniature Africa, from its coastal lagoons and palm-fringed beaches to the forested hills and the dry grasslands of the north. It is a land of incredible cultural and geographical richness, offering a concentrated and authentic journey into the heart of West African traditions.
